Java如何实现CMS系统中的文档转换功能?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1198个文字,预计阅读时间需要5分钟。

如何用Java实现CMS系统的文档转换功能?在内容管理系统(CMS)中,文档转换功能是一项重要功能。它允许用户将不同格式的文档转换为其他格式,以便于共享、编辑和阅读。在本文中,文档转换是指将一种文档格式(如Word、PDF、Excel等)转换为另一种格式。以下是实现该功能的步骤:
1. 选择文档转换库:首先,选择一个适合Java的文档转换库,如Apache POI、iText、Apache PDFBox等。这些库提供了丰富的API,可以方便地处理各种文档格式。
2. 解析源文档:使用选择的库解析源文档。例如,若源文档为PDF,则使用PDFBox库解析文档内容。
3. 转换文档格式:根据需求将解析后的文档内容转换为目标格式。例如,将PDF转换为Word,将Excel转换为CSV等。
4. 输出目标格式文档:将转换后的文档输出到指定位置,可以是本地文件系统或网络存储。
本文共计1198个文字,预计阅读时间需要5分钟。

如何用Java实现CMS系统的文档转换功能?在内容管理系统(CMS)中,文档转换功能是一项重要功能。它允许用户将不同格式的文档转换为其他格式,以便于共享、编辑和阅读。在本文中,文档转换是指将一种文档格式(如Word、PDF、Excel等)转换为另一种格式。以下是实现该功能的步骤:
1. 选择文档转换库:首先,选择一个适合Java的文档转换库,如Apache POI、iText、Apache PDFBox等。这些库提供了丰富的API,可以方便地处理各种文档格式。
2. 解析源文档:使用选择的库解析源文档。例如,若源文档为PDF,则使用PDFBox库解析文档内容。
3. 转换文档格式:根据需求将解析后的文档内容转换为目标格式。例如,将PDF转换为Word,将Excel转换为CSV等。
4. 输出目标格式文档:将转换后的文档输出到指定位置,可以是本地文件系统或网络存储。

